Ticket #4182 — Postmortem follow-up: stale-cache bug in Quibblet staging. Quick recap for the security review: the staging env was pointed at the prod cache cluster, so invalidation events never landed and users saw day-old pricing. Root cause was a copy-pasted env file from the old Harlowe deploy. Fix is merged; staging now gets its own cluster and a dedicated invalidation credential. For reference, the corrected env file sets the cache auth on the next line.

secret setting of yagef-baweg: RELAY_SECRET29=cb53deb59a49ed54d9f43599b54ca

☐ Color-contrast audit for the Mistvale dashboard: confirm all text meets the 4.5:1 ratio and interactive controls meet 3:1, per the Ashgrove accessibility standard. Check both the default and dusk themes; the warning banners failed last quarter. Record failing components in the audit log. If paged about contrast regressions, escalate to the audit owner named below.

approver of faduf-bagug = Framir Sorwyn

Ticket DV-2218: The Slabview diff viewer now streams files over 500MB through a chunked renderer instead of loading them into memory. This changes how temporary buffers are written to local disk, and the cleanup path runs with elevated permissions on shared build hosts. Security review is required before the Torvale release branch is cut. Test coverage includes path traversal and symlink cases; results are attached to the ticket. Please confirm the buffer lifecycle meets policy. Sign-off is required from the engineer below.

named custodian: Fraion Holael